Transaction 60260714fec7ba5b80b43c477577d220927c6daa52c73687f7a62ba70d71c20b
1 Input
2 Outputs
- 60260714fec7ba5b80b43c477577d220927c6daa52c73687f7a62ba70d71c20b:0
- 60260714fec7ba5b80b43c477577d220927c6daa52c73687f7a62ba70d71c20b:1
value 8457506
address 1PiEQbehmkQVfWLsPD4UAfkFjjYzu8UCuD
value 931606843
address 1NQ84avNM5XXzx2EzE9b9VYfqQN24dQT1L